Decorate a galley kitchen.

Galley kitchens are shaped like a rectangle, with cabinets on both sides. If you live in a small apartment or an older home, you probably have a galley kitchen. Galley kitchens tend to be fairly small. With a little organization and decorating, you won't mind cooking in your small galley kitchen. Does this Spark an idea?

Instructions

    • 1

      Make everything functional. If you leave appliances such as toasters or mixers on the counter, make them look like sculptures. Choose appliances with sleek metal, or a fun color like pink or orange. These functional items add instant decoration.

    • 2

      Maximize vertical space. Hang a pot rack for extra storage. Install cabinets that go all the way to the ceiling for additional storage space.

    • 3

      Choose small appliances. Look for appliances that are specifically made for rentals or condos. These functional fridges and stoves will save you a few precious inches.

    • 4

      Use high-end materials. Since the space is small, it will cost less to add flourishes like marble or granite counter tops or floors.

    • 5

      Create a pass-through. Depending on the architecture of your home, you may be able to take out a wall in your galley kitchen to open up the space. Turn the pass-through into an island. Place bar stools on the other side of the pass-through. This is efficient because galley kitchens rarely include breakfast nooks or kitchen islands. The negative side is that you'll lose the upper cabinets. Make sure that you can afford to do without the extra storage space. Your guests will be able to congregate in larger rooms without isolating you in the kitchen.

    • 6

      Bring in light. Replace your fluorescent lighting. Change out your back door with a French door. Add under-cabinet lights to create fresh, cheery space.
